About

Janice obtained her Master of Science degree in Occupational Therapy from the University of Toronto. She holds a Bachelor of Arts degree in Psychology and Social Anthropology from Dalhousie University. She also holds a certificate in Disability Management from Dalhousie University, and a certificate in Cognitive Behavioural Therapy from Wilfred Laurier University.

Janice practices as both an occupational therapist and a psychotherapist. 

As an occupational therapist, she has extensive experience working with clients with chronic mental health concerns, psychological trauma, chronic pain, neurological injuries, and physical health concerns. She also has experience working with cognitive injuries, burns, and physical polytrauma. She collaborates with clients to help with activity scheduling, behavioural activation, community re-integration, energy conservation strategies, sleep hygiene, stages of mental health and cognitive recovery, distress tolerance, and mindfulness. She holds training in Progressive Goal Attainment Program (PGAP), Sensory Enhanced Yoga for Self-regulation and Trauma, neurobiology of trauma, concussion management, chronic pain management, crisis intervention, exposure therapy and relaxation skills training. She is passionate about providing treatment that is client-centered and practicing trauma-informed care. Janice believes educating her clients on the underlying neurobiology and physiology behind their conditions and occupational therapy treatment. She enjoys working together with clients in a collaborative process to create individualized strategies that support them in achieving goals that are meaningful to the person.

Janice also provides counselling and psychotherapy services. She has training in a number of psychotherapy modalities and protocols including cognitive behavioural therapy for trauma (CBT-T), Cognitive Processing Therapy (CPT), unified protocol for transdiagnostic treatment of emotional disorders (UP), and motivational interviewing. She regularly participates in courses, workshops, and seminars to further her knowledge and skill, integrating a variety of methods into her practice to tailor treatment to her clients’ unique needs and goals.
